制作步骤

  • 1 - Prepare Glasses:
    Chill two tall glasses (highballs) in the freezer or fill them with ice water while you prep.
  • 2 - Add Base Flavours:
    Add 4 thin cucumber slices and a pinch of sea salt flakes to each chilled glass.
  • 3 - Build the Cocktail:
    In a shaker, combine gin, elderflower liqueur, and lime juice with ice. Shake gently for 15 seconds.
  • 4 - Layer and Combine:
    Discard chilling ice or water from glasses. Fill glasses to the brim with fresh crushed ice. Strain the shaken mixture evenly into both glasses.
  • 5 - Add Fizz and Garnish:
    Top each glass with tonic water. Give a gentle stir, making sure cucumber and salt mingle. Garnish with thyme sprig (optional). Serve immediately.

Tips, Notes & Unique Aspects

  • Botanicals: An artisanal London dry gin amplifies character. Play with boutique gins featuring sea-herbs or coastal botanicals for extra dimension.
  • Salt: Always use flaky salt with clean flavor, such as Maldon or Cornish sea salt. A grind of rock salt is a poor substitute.
  • Elderflower: If liqueur isn’t available, a splash of elderflower cordial and a little more gin will produce a similar sweetness.
  • Herbs: Fresh thyme is pictured for garnish. For an earthier dimension, lemon balm or rosemary serve well.
  • Fizzy Final Touch: Quality tonic water (such as Fever-Tree) grants the drink gentle floral effervescence instead of overpowering sharpness.
  • Preparation: Serve this drink with abundant crushed ice to mimic the chill and unfiltered frostiness of North Sea tides.
  • Pairings: The bracingly clean flavor profile means salted almonds, fresh oysters, or cucumber tea sandwiches all match splendidly.
